I even enjoy the severe ones . Our chimmeny got hit jumped to the house wireing and destroyed every tv ,computer oven controls , put pinholes in the gas lines in water heater , stove and gas dryer .the chimmeny exploded damaged two cars and put a hole in the porch roof . I now am protected by lightening rods on both house and shop .Being a vol. fireman I go to house fires every year started by lightening

Wow! Dancing around excitedly, I watched a spectacular lightning storm in September 2012. Over 100 wildfires were started by one lightning storm in Chelan County, WA. High winds merged fires.

Due to heavy smoke in Wenatchee, my doctor ordered me to evacuate. With asthma, I couldn't breathe.

Hazardous air quality levels are 301 to 500 ppm. In Wenatchee, the air quality level was 1,300 ppm. I evacuated west to Sequim, WA for nine weeks.
